23/* This test case and code is based on the bug recipe Joe Malicki provided for
24 * bug report #1871269, fixed on Jan 14 2008 before the 7.18.0 release.
25 */
26
27#include "test.h"
28
29#include "memdebug.h"
30
31#define POSTLEN 40960
32
33static size_t myreadfunc(void *ptr, size_t size, size_t nmemb, void *stream)
34{
35  static size_t total=POSTLEN;
36  static char buf[1024];
37  (void)stream;
38
39  memset(buf, 'A', sizeof(buf));
40
41  size *= nmemb;
42  if (size > total)
43    size = total;
44
45  if(size > sizeof(buf))
46    size = sizeof(buf);
47
48  memcpy(ptr, buf, size);
49  total -= size;
50  return size;
51}
52
53#define NUM_HEADERS 8
54#define SIZE_HEADERS 5000
55
56static char buf[SIZE_HEADERS + 100];
57
58int test(char *URL)
59{
60  CURL *curl;
61  CURLcode res = CURLE_FAILED_INIT;
62  int i;
63  struct curl_slist *headerlist=NULL, *hl;
64
65  if(curl_global_init(CURL_GLOBAL_ALL) != CURLE_OK) {
66    fprintf(stderr, "curl_global_init() failed\n");
67    return TEST_ERR_MAJOR_BAD;
68  }
69
70  if((curl = curl_easy_init()) == NULL) {
71    fprintf(stderr, "curl_easy_init() failed\n");
72    curl_global_cleanup();
73    return TEST_ERR_MAJOR_BAD;
74  }
75
76  for (i = 0; i < NUM_HEADERS; i++) {
77    int len = sprintf(buf, "Header%d: ", i);
78    memset(&buf[len], 'A', SIZE_HEADERS);
79    buf[len + SIZE_HEADERS]=0; /* zero terminate */
80    hl = curl_slist_append(headerlist,  buf);
81    if (!hl)
82      goto test_cleanup;
83    headerlist = hl;
84  }
85
86  hl = curl_slist_append(headerlist, "Expect: ");
87  if (!hl)
88    goto test_cleanup;
89  headerlist = hl;
90
91  test_setopt(curl, CURLOPT_URL, URL);
92  test_setopt(curl, CURLOPT_HTTPHEADER, headerlist);
93  test_setopt(curl, CURLOPT_POST, 1L);
94#ifdef CURL_DOES_CONVERSIONS
95  /* Convert the POST data to ASCII */
96  test_setopt(curl, CURLOPT_TRANSFERTEXT, 1L);
97#endif
98  test_setopt(curl, CURLOPT_POSTFIELDSIZE, (long)POSTLEN);
99  test_setopt(curl, CURLOPT_VERBOSE, 1L);
100  test_setopt(curl, CURLOPT_HEADER, 1L);
101  test_setopt(curl, CURLOPT_READFUNCTION, myreadfunc);
102
103  res = curl_easy_perform(curl);
104
105test_cleanup:
106
107  curl_easy_cleanup(curl);
108
109  curl_slist_free_all(headerlist);
110
111  curl_global_cleanup();
112
113  return (int)res;
114}
